In this tutorial we’ll show you 4 simple ways to check your computer uptime in Windows 10 / 8 / 7. This is useful when troubleshooting problems or checking the last boot time due to a power outage. Press the Ctrl + Shift + Esc keyboard shortcut to start Task Manager. Open Windows PowerShell and type the following command: Once pressing Enter, you’ll get the uptime information on a list format with the days, hours, minutes, seconds and milliseconds. Right-click on an active network adapter and then select Status from the popup menu.
